Frage

Ich erhalte diese Störung versuchen alle Ultrasphinx Rake-Befehle (unter Linux Terminal) wie Rake ultrasphinx auszuführen: configure:

rake aborted!
no such file to load -- echoe
/var/www/gitorious/vendor/plugins/ultrasphinx/Rakefile:2:in `require'
/var/www/gitorious/vendor/plugins/ultrasphinx/Rakefile:2
/usr/lib/ruby/1.8/rake.rb:2359:in `load'
/usr/lib/ruby/1.8/rake.rb:2359:in `raw_load_rakefile'
/usr/lib/ruby/1.8/rake.rb:1993:in `load_rakefile'
/usr/lib/ruby/1.8/rake.rb:2044:in `standard_exception_handling'
/usr/lib/ruby/1.8/rake.rb:1992:in `load_rakefile'
/usr/lib/ruby/1.8/rake.rb:1976:in `run'
/usr/lib/ruby/1.8/rake.rb:2044:in `standard_exception_handling'
/usr/lib/ruby/1.8/rake.rb:1974:in `run'
/usr/bin/rake:28

Ich nehme an das bedeutet echoe Juwel nicht installiert ist. Aber wenn ich „Juwel Liste --local“ run zeigt es, dass der echoe gem installiert ist. Was könnte das Problem hier sein und wie kann ich debuggen das?

War es hilfreich?

Lösung

Haben Sie versucht, die echoe Version zu aktualisieren?

sudo gem update echoe

Es ist seltsam. Alle ultrasphinx Aufgabe in einer .rake Datei richtig definiert, ohne durch das Plugin Rakefile Datei von Rails geladen werden sollen.

Auch sollten Sie Ihr

rake ultrasphinx:configure

aus dem Projekt Wurzel und nicht das Plugin Wurzel.

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ow
scroll top